I have a probook4535s hard drive imminent failure (error 303) & need to replace it asap it is a 300gb, can I replace it with a - 1TB Seagate Barracuda SATA 6Gb/s, 7200rpm, 64MB Cache internal Hard Drive.

Yes you can fit that hard drive, but try a ssd solid state hard drive 500gig samsung pro evo series you can get them in kit form.

Ssd drive a USB to sata cable and transfer software the boot times when changed are fantastic.

I would agree with single bloke, the Samsung ssd would be an excellent replacement. also last time I purchased one it came with a sata to USB cable and cloning software, so I was able to completely clone the laptop and replace the drive in about 1 hour. Look for the starter kit unless you already have connection and cloning software.

Change for ssd (solid state drive) small but fast and unlikely to fail. Use it for os and programmes. Save all data to external hard drive so you don't lose anything.
